Make certain that you have a trustworthy Internet presence. Don’t overhype offers and ads. Alternately, focus on fact-based offers that show the value of your product to customers. Be transparent and you should find people find you more trustworthy.

Privacy issues need to be dealt with immediately. Keep track of the leads that you’ve had opt out of getting incentives and offers. Otherwise, you may develop a reputation as a spammer.

Original Leads

Check that you are getting original leads in your campaigns. It is common to buy leads quickly without checking for duplicates. You’ll end up with the same lead over and over again. Target original leads so you don’t spam them.

If your job is relevant, think about speaking at local businesses. If you happen to be a seasoned landscaper, you may want to speak about creating curb appeal. Yoga instructors can give tips for easy stretches that can be done quickly through the day. You might be able to teach others valuable information.

Try to find local groups that help with lead generation. This is a collection of business owners who gather to swap leads. You might be surprised to find that a dentist might find you a lead, even though you are a masseuse. You can send a referral back to them when a customer has a toothache.

Take advantage of online lead groups. If the business you have is mostly local, you will find help from these groups. Though Jim may not have the ability to service Jane’s pest issues, he can pass along your information to help her out.
